SCHANNEL_CERT_HASH_STORE構造体 (schannel.h)

Schannel がカーネル モードで使用する証明書のハッシュ ストア データを格納します。

構文

typedef struct _SCHANNEL_CERT_HASH_STORE {
  DWORD      dwLength;
  DWORD      dwFlags;
  HCRYPTPROV hProv;
  BYTE       ShaHash[20];
  WCHAR      pwszStoreName[SCH_CRED_MAX_STORE_NAME_SIZE];
} SCHANNEL_CERT_HASH_STORE, *PSCHANNEL_CERT_HASH_STORE;

メンバー

dwLength

この構造体のサイズ (バイト単位)。

dwFlags

Schannel の動作を制御するビット フラグが含まれています。 このメンバーには、0 または次の値を指定できます。

意味
SCH_MACHINE_CERT_HASH
0x00000001
コンピューターの証明書ハッシュ。

hProv

暗号化プロバイダーに対する処理。

ShaHash[20]

セキュリティで保護されたハッシュ アルゴリズム。

pwszStoreName[SCH_CRED_MAX_STORE_NAME_SIZE]

ストア名のサイズへのポインター。

要件

要件
サポートされている最小のクライアント Windows 7 [デスクトップ アプリのみ]
サポートされている最小のサーバー Windows Server 2008 [デスクトップ アプリのみ]
Header schannel.h